OEM Cylindrical Roller Bearings are designed to support radial loads and are particularly effective in handling high-speed operations. But what exactly sets these bearings apart? Their construction, which features cylindrical rollers, allows for a larger contact area with the raceway, distributing loads more evenly and reducing stress on the bearings. This leads to improved durability and reduced friction—essential elements for machinery longevity.

The application scenarios for OEM Cylindrical Roller Bearings are vast. In the automotive sector, they are used in transmissions, gearboxes, and other rotating parts. For example, in truck axles, these bearings help handle the heavy loads and high speeds typical of long-haul trucking. In the industrial manufacturing world, these bearings facilitate the smooth operation of conveyor systems and rotating machinery. Furthermore, in wind turbine construction, OEM Cylindrical Roller Bearings manage the heavy loads experienced during operation and contribute to the longevity of the turbine's components. In railroad applications, these bearings are critical for the efficiency of wheelsets, ensuring trains can run smoothly and efficiently.
